01 How can I book a tour?
You can book a tour by phone or by email. Your booking becomes final after confirmation, so it’s best to contact us in advance to discuss your preferred date, the number of participants, and any special requests you may have.
02 Where is the meeting point?
The meeting point is in Borzont. We’ll send you the exact departure location and all arrival details when your booking is confirmed, so everyone can arrive comfortably and on time before the tour begins.
03 Can children take part?
Yes, buggy tours can be a great experience for families too. Each buggy can carry up to 4 people, so participation depends on available seats and the type of tour. However, only someone with a valid driving licence is allowed to drive the buggy.
04 What happens in bad weather?
Tours take place depending on weather conditions. If the weather is unsafe or not suitable for the route, we’ll discuss the available options with you. In lighter weather changes, the right equipment helps keep the tour comfortable and enjoyable.
05 Are the tours guided?
Yes, every buggy tour is guided. The guide leads the group, helps everyone follow the route, and makes sure the tour is safe, well organized, and full of great moments.
06 Who can drive the buggy?
Only people with a valid driving licence can drive the buggy. Before departure, drivers must complete a liability form. The buggies have automatic transmission, so they are easy to drive, but every driver must follow the safety rules.
07 How many people can sit in one buggy?
Each buggy can carry up to 4 people. The exact arrangement is agreed based on the number of participants, booking details, and available buggies.
08 What equipment do you provide?
During the tour, we provide a protective jacket, trousers, helmet, helmet mask, safety goggles, and water. This equipment is provided for your comfort and safety, so we ask all participants to use it according to the guide’s instructions.
09 What should I bring with me?
We recommend bringing only small personal items that fit comfortably in your pocket. Large bags, backpacks, or items that can easily be lost are not recommended, as they may be uncomfortable or unsafe during the buggy tour.
10 What should I wear?
We recommend dressing in layers, as the temperature can feel different while driving and during the stops. If you get warm along the way, the stops give you a chance to adjust comfortably. It’s best to arrive in comfortable clothes suitable for outdoor activities and clothes you don’t mind getting a little dusty.
11 Can we switch drivers during the tour?
Yes, there will be stops during the tour where drivers can switch. Please let the guide know in advance. Of course, only someone with a valid driving licence can take over the driver’s seat.
12 What rules must be followed during the tour?
During the tour, the guide’s instructions must be followed at all times. A distance of at least 20 metres must be kept between buggies, and everyone should pay attention to safe driving. Alcohol consumption during the tour is strictly prohibited.
13 Can alcohol be consumed before or during the tour?
No. For safety reasons, alcohol consumption during the tour is strictly prohibited, and the buggy may only be driven by someone who is in a safe and suitable condition to drive. This is in everyone’s best interest.
